December 24, 1996 - Stephen Paulus is the first American composer to have a carol performed at the Festival of Nine Lessons and Carols at Kings College, Cambridge. The text of the carol was written by poet Kevin Crossley-Holland who was a Fulbright Visiting Scholar at Saint Olaf College and Endowed Chair in Humanities and Fine Arts at the University of Saint Thomas.
